The Professional Book Nerds podcast is now, Book Lounge by LibbyBook Lounge by Libby is the podcast where authors, book lovers, and industry insiders come together to talk about the stories we love and the impact they have. Hosted by Joe Skelley, each episode invites you into a cozy, candid conversation about books, writing, publishing, and the trends shaping the literary world.PLUS, every episode features book recommendations from some of your favorite online content creators.Book Lounge airs two seasons per year, along with special monthly episodes. Whether you're into sweeping romances, chilling thrillers, epic fantasies, or powerful memoirs, there's something in the Lounge for every reader. Celebrating Valentine's Day with Dominique Raccah and the Sourcebooks Team!
Romance readers, assemble! This episode is for you. Emma chats with Dominique Raccah, Publisher and CEO, of Sourcebooks, the publisher behind some of your favorite romance reads at Sourcebooks Casablanca and Bloom Books imprints. They’re joined by Paula Amendolara (Senior Vice President of Sales), Mary Altman (Assistant Editorial Director), Molly Waxman (Executive Director of Marketing), Deb Werksman (Executive Editor), and Pamela Jaffee (Sr. Director Publicity/Brand Marketing), just some of the incredible team at Bloom Books and Sourcebooks Casablanca. They discuss insider info about how the publisher approaches each romance imprint, share trends in romance, and leave us with a long list of titles to get in the Valentine's Day spirit all February long.Books mentioned in this episode:
